Job description

The Sr. FinOps Analyst will work across Cox Automotive to direct and perform financial analysis and reporting activities, focusing on Cloud platform providers and SaaS software. Creates accounting charge backs for an expanding roster of strategic technology vendors. Gathers, analyzes, prepares and summarizes recommendations for optimizing spend. Develops, implements and monitors financial metrics, focusing on Cloud consumption. Consults with product development teams and executive leadership to share cost trends, cost drivers, and optimization opportunities.

Cox Automotive is transforming the way the world buys, sells, owns, and uses cars using our vast array of automotive solutions (Autotrader, KBB, Manheim, Dealer.com, VinSolutions, vAuto, Xtime, DealerTrack, and more). Our successful cloud transformation is unleashing innovation in our business, and we are expanding our Financial Operations (FinOps) capability to continue to successfully govern and manage our technology strategy and spend.

Candidates may reside in Atlanta, Georgia or Burlington, Vermont

Internal Cox employees may reside in any corporate office location.

All must follow In-office hybrid schedule

Who You Are

An experienced Technology professional with an understanding of Cloud provider (AWS, Azure, Google Cloud Platform) and AI platform (Anthropic, Microsoft Copilot, AWS Quick, AWS Bedrock) cost management.

What You'll Do
  • Create monthly accounting chargeback and showbacks for strategic technology spend to allocate costs to different business units or projects
  • Identify and alert on cloud and AI cost anomalies in a timely fashion
  • Think independently to solve difficult data problems
  • Collate, analyze, and prioritize technology optimization recommendations and calculate potential savings
  • Monitor ongoing cloud and AI expenses and identify cost‑saving opportunities, such as unused or underutilized resources
  • Over time, develop expertise to provide expert knowledge of cloud and AI cost optimization strategies (e.g. rightsizing, reservations, scheduling and scaling, model use, caching, etc.)
  • Collaborate with product engineering teams to implement cost optimization recommendations and best practices
  • Utilize data to tell compelling stories by visualizing technology usage, driving technology cost optimization practices within product engineering teams
  • Stay up to date with industry trends and regulations related to FinOps and technology cost optimization
  • Generate regular reports and dashboards to provide visibility into technology spending and cost trends.
  • Conduct in‑depth cost analysis to identify cost drivers and areas for improvement.
  • Conduct analysis of multiple complex cost proposals
  • Effectively communicating your insights and plans to cross‑functional team members and management.
